![]() ![]() Paint.NET can be used to enhance and clean up your photographs. The programming language used to create Paint.NET is C#, with a small amount of C++ for installation and shell-integration related functionality. Originally intended as a free replacement for the MS Paint software that comes withWindows, it has grown into a powerful yet simple tool for photo and image editing. It started development as an undergraduate college senior design project mentored by Microsoft, and is currently being maintained by some of the alumni that originally worked on it. It supports layers, unlimited undo, special effects, and a wide variety of useful and powerful tools. Paint.NET also remembers all the changes you have made to the image and you can undo your way back to the beginning if you want!
